May Kihara is a scholar working on Molecular Biology, Genetics and Ecology. According to data from OpenAlex, May Kihara has authored 30 papers receiving a total of 2.2k indexed citations (citations by other indexed papers that have themselves been cited), including 26 papers in Molecular Biology, 20 papers in Genetics and 10 papers in Ecology. Recurrent topics in May Kihara’s work include Bacterial Genetics and Biotechnology (20 papers), Bacteriophages and microbial interactions (10 papers) and Protein Structure and Dynamics (7 papers). May Kihara is often cited by papers focused on Bacterial Genetics and Biotechnology (20 papers), Bacteriophages and microbial interactions (10 papers) and Protein Structure and Dynamics (7 papers). May Kihara collaborates with scholars based in United States, Japan and Mexico. May Kihara's co-authors include Robert M. Macnab, Shigeru Yamaguchi, Tohru Minamino, Keiichi Namba, V M Irikura, Hedda U. Ferris, Shin-Ichi Aizawa, Mitsuo Isomura, Christopher J. Jones and Bertha González‐Pedrajo and has published in prestigious journals such as Journal of Biological Chemistry, Journal of Molecular Biology and FEBS Letters.
